Central government is strict on paper leaks, students will not be targeted; Bill introduced in Parliament

The Union Cabinet had recently approved the Public Examinations (Prevention of Unfair Means) Bill, 2024. After this it was presented in Parliament on Monday. Students will not be targeted in the proposed bill. According to this, provisions for strict action are included against those found involved in organized crime, mafia and collusion. The Bill also proposes a high-level technical committee, which will make recommendations to make the examination process through computers more secure. This will be a central law and it will also cover joint entrance examinations and examinations for admission to central universities.
